A serial killer bored to death in Covid quarantine and desperate for a victim picks up an innocent hitchhiker, but what he thinks will be a quick and easy kill, turns into a long and challenging night.
2015
1958
1942
1999
2023
1997
2021
2020
1995
1977
2016
—
2008
2014
2013